Dr Ashvin Nair is a Cardiothoracic Surgeon who specialises in surgical diseases related to the heart, lungs and chest. He graduated from the University of Manchester, United Kingdom in 2010. He did his foundation and basic surgical training at the Manchester Royal Infirmary. Subsequently he returned to Malaysia and joined UMMC in 2013 and became a Member of the Royal College of Surgeons in Ireland (MRCS) in 2015. Following that, he was appointed as one of the pioneer National Cardiothoracic Surgery trainees in the Cardiothoracic Surgery Fellowship Programme in collaboration with the Royal College of Surgeons of Edinburgh in 2016. Having completed his training, he was awarded the qualification Fellow of Royal College of Surgeons of Edinburgh in the specialty of Cardiothoracic Surgery (FRCSEd C-Th) in 2022. He further undertook a clinical fellowship in Adult Cardiac Surgery at the internationally renowned Royal Papworth Hospital, Cambridge (UK). He has gained vast experience in diagnosis, management and operative skills in the field of cardiac and thoracic surgery. He also has a keen interest in Minimally Invasive Cardiac Surgery, surgical education and clinical research.
